How to Overcome Problem Gambling

Gambling

Problem Gambling is a complex condition, and there are various ways to treat it. Often, the urge to gamble is self-soothing, and it can also help you to relax and socialize. However, problem gambling can cause more harm than good. It can damage relationships, finances, and your health. For these reasons, it is important to seek help. Fortunately, there are several resources to help you overcome your addiction. Here are some tips:

Budget your finances to limit gambling expenses. The first rule to keep in mind when gambling is to expect to lose. Since gambling involves chance, you should plan to lose. Always budget for gambling as an expense. This includes casino gaming and other chance-based activities. While you should bet only with money you can afford, you should try to limit your spending on gambling. Some people even consider it a form of entertainment, so it’s a smart idea to set aside a certain amount of money each month for it.

Another tip is to limit your gaming hours. If you’re not able to afford to spend all your time gambling, consider limiting your gambling hours. If you’re constantly losing, it may be best to cut back on gambling, and find a new hobby. By restricting your gaming time, you’ll be able to focus on other priorities, such as getting a job or paying off debts. If you’re not sure how much you can spend, check out Wiktionary.
